Home Depot remains focused on stores as online business grows
April 11, 2017
Home Depot grew from $500 million in online sales in 2009 to $5 billion last year, making it one of the largest e-commerce retailers in the U.S. Despite its online success, the chain sees improving the in-store experience for contractors and regular consumers as the key to its future short- and long-term prospects.
